本发明涉及眼镜设备,特别涉及一种眼镜设备的虚像显示控制方法、装置、设备及计算机可读存储介质。
背景技术:
1、目前,如ar(augmented reality,增强现实)眼镜和mr(mediated reality,混合现实)眼镜等智能眼镜设备逐渐融入车辆智能座舱。例如,车辆内的驾驶员和乘客可使用ar眼镜,利用ar眼镜的虚实结合能力,提高车辆内人员的乘车体验。
2、如图1所示,眼镜设备中的虚像的显示要尽可能保证虚像和外界的实物相结合,以满足用户的使用需求;比如驾驶员佩戴的ar眼镜上显示的虚拟导航箭头可以放置在驾驶员前方10m处与地面贴合,不能悬浮在空中遮挡视线。现有技术中,对于不同车辆内不同人员,由于个人身高和驾驶车辆的习惯不同,使得用户每次使用眼镜设备均需要手动调整虚像位置,以保证虚像和实物完美结合,十分影响用户体验,并且会对驾驶员用户产生一定安全隐患。
3、因此,如何能够实现车辆内眼镜设备的虚像位置的自动调整,提高眼镜设备的虚实结合能力,提升用户体验,是现今急需解决的问题。
技术实现思路
1、本发明的目的是提供一种眼镜设备的虚像显示控制方法、装置、设备及计算机可读存储介质,以车辆内眼镜设备的虚像位置的自动调整,提高眼镜设备的虚实结合能力,提升用户体验。
2、为解决上述技术问题,本发明提供一种眼镜设备的虚像显示控制方法,包括:
3、获取车辆的座椅状态信息;其中,所述座椅状态信息包括座椅高度;
4、根据所述座椅状态信息和预存坐姿参数,确定用户眼部竖直高度;其中,所述预存坐姿参数包括用户坐姿眼部高度;
5、根据所述用户眼部竖直高度和预存虚像位置参数,确定眼镜设备的虚像显示位置;其中,所述预存虚像位置参数包括虚像水平距离;
6、控制所述眼镜设备在所述虚像显示位置显示待显示虚像。
7、在一些实施例中,所述根据所述座椅状态信息和预存坐姿参数,确定用户眼部竖直高度,包括:
8、将所述座椅高度与所述用户坐姿眼部高度之和确定为所述用户眼部竖直高度。
9、在一些实施例中,所述座椅状态信息还包括座椅倾斜角度,所述根据所述座椅状态信息和预存坐姿参数,确定用户眼部竖直高度,包括:
10、根据所述座椅倾斜角度和所述用户坐姿眼部高度,计算用户当前坐姿眼部高度;
11、将所述座椅高度与所述用户当前坐姿眼部高度之和确定为所述用户眼部竖直高度。
12、在一些实施例中,所述根据所述用户眼部竖直高度和预存虚像位置参数,确定眼镜设备的虚像显示位置,包括:
13、根据所述用户眼部竖直高度和所述虚像水平距离,计算所述虚像显示位置;其中,所述虚像显示位置包括虚像角度和所述虚像角度上的虚像距离。
14、在一些实施例中,所述获取车辆的座椅状态信息,包括:
15、所述眼镜设备接收所述车辆发送的所述座椅状态信息。
16、在一些实施例中,该方法还包括:
17、根据获取的虚像位置调整指令,调整所述眼镜设备显示的虚像的位置;其中,所述虚像位置调整指令包括竖直方向位置调整指令;
18、获取虚像位置确定指令后,根据所述眼镜设备上显示的虚像的当前位置和当前座椅状态信息,更新所述预存坐姿参数和所述预存虚像位置参数。
19、在一些实施例中,所述根据所述眼镜设备上显示的虚像的当前位置和当前座椅状态信息,更新所述预存坐姿参数和所述预存虚像位置参数,包括:
20、所述眼镜设备根据显示的虚像的当前位置,确定当前虚像角度和当前虚像水平距离;
21、根据当前虚像角度、当前虚像水平距离和当前座椅状态信息,更新所述用户坐姿眼部高度和所述虚像水平距离。
22、本发明还提供了一种眼镜设备的虚像显示控制装置,包括:
23、车辆获取模块,用于获取车辆的座椅状态信息;其中,所述座椅状态信息包括座椅高度;
24、高度确定模块,用于根据所述座椅状态信息和预存坐姿参数,确定用户眼部竖直高度;其中,所述预存坐姿参数包括用户坐姿眼部高度;
25、位置确定模块,用于根据所述用户眼部竖直高度和预存虚像位置参数,确定眼镜设备的虚像显示位置;其中,所述预存虚像位置参数包括虚像水平距离;
26、虚像显示模块,用于控制所述眼镜设备在所述虚像显示位置显示待显示虚像。
27、本发明还提供了一种眼镜设备的虚像显示控制设备,包括:
28、存储器,用于存储计算机程序;
29、处理器,用于执行所述计算机程序时实现如上述所述的眼镜设备的虚像显示控制方法的步骤。
30、此外,本发明还提供了一种计算机可读存储介质,所述计算机可读存储介质上存储有计算机程序,所述计算机程序被处理器执行时实现如上述所述的眼镜设备的虚像显示控制方法的步骤。
31、本发明所提供的一种眼镜设备的虚像显示控制方法,包括:获取车辆的座椅状态信息;其中,座椅状态信息包括座椅高度;根据座椅状态信息和预存坐姿参数,确定用户眼部竖直高度;其中,预存坐姿参数包括用户坐姿眼部高度;根据用户眼部竖直高度和预存虚像位置参数,确定眼镜设备的虚像显示位置;其中,预存虚像位置参数包括虚像水平距离;控制眼镜设备在虚像显示位置显示待显示虚像;
32、可见,本发明通过获取车辆的座椅状态信息,能够利用用户所在的车辆的座椅状态信息和预先存储的与用户自身情况相关的预存坐姿参数和预存虚像位置参数,自动确定眼镜设备的虚像显示位置,从而实现车辆内眼镜设备的虚像位置的自适应调整,提高眼镜设备的虚实结合能力和使用便利性,提升了用户体验。此外,本发明还提供了一种眼镜设备的虚像显示控制装置、设备及计算机可读存储介质,同样具有上述有益效果。
1.一种眼镜设备的虚像显示控制方法,其特征在于,包括:
2.根据权利要求1所述的眼镜设备的虚像显示控制方法,其特征在于,所述根据所述座椅状态信息和预存坐姿参数,确定用户眼部竖直高度,包括:
3.根据权利要求1所述的眼镜设备的虚像显示控制方法,其特征在于,所述座椅状态信息还包括座椅倾斜角度,所述根据所述座椅状态信息和预存坐姿参数,确定用户眼部竖直高度,包括:
4.根据权利要求1所述的眼镜设备的虚像显示控制方法,其特征在于,所述根据所述用户眼部竖直高度和预存虚像位置参数,确定眼镜设备的虚像显示位置,包括:
5.根据权利要求1所述的眼镜设备的虚像显示控制方法,其特征在于,所述获取车辆的座椅状态信息,包括:
6.根据权利要求1至5任一项所述的眼镜设备的虚像显示控制方法,其特征在于,还包括:
7.根据权利要求6所述的眼镜设备的虚像显示控制方法,其特征在于,所述根据所述眼镜设备上显示的虚像的当前位置和当前座椅状态信息,更新所述预存坐姿参数和所述预存虚像位置参数,包括:
8.一种眼镜设备的虚像显示控制装置,其特征在于,包括:
9.一种眼镜设备的虚像显示控制设备,其特征在于,包括:
10.一种计算机可读存储介质,其特征在于,所述计算机可读存储介质上存储有计算机程序,所述计算机程序被处理器执行时实现如权利要求1至7任一项所述的眼镜设备的虚像显示控制方法的步骤。